Conventional Cataract Surgical Treatment Benefits And Drawbacks
When thinking about traditional cataract surgical procedure, you might discover that it's a well-established and widely-used strategy. In this treatment, a specialist makes a tiny incision in the eye and makes use of ultrasound to separate the over cast lens before removing it. When the cataract is gotten rid of, a fabricated lens is inserted to bring back clear vision.
Among Leading LASIK Doctor of standard cataract surgery is its performance history of success. Lots of people have had their vision considerably boosted through this procedure. Additionally, conventional surgical procedure is often covered by insurance coverage, making it a much more easily accessible alternative for numerous people.
Nonetheless, there are some downsides to typical cataract surgical procedure too. Recuperation time can be much longer compared to more recent methods, and there's a slightly higher danger of complications such as infection or swelling. Some individuals may likewise experience astigmatism or need analysis glasses post-surgery.
Laser-Assisted Techniques Pros and Cons
Checking out laser-assisted methods for cataract surgical procedure reveals a contemporary approach that uses laser innovation to do essential steps in the treatment. Among the primary advantages of laser-assisted cataract surgery is its precision. The laser permits very precise lacerations, which can bring about much better aesthetic outcomes. Additionally, making use of lasers can lower the amount of ultrasound energy needed throughout the surgical procedure, possibly lowering the risk of difficulties such as corneal damages.
On the drawback, laser-assisted techniques can be much more expensive contrasted to conventional techniques. This price mightn't be covered by insurance, making it much less obtainable to some individuals.
Another consideration is that not all cataract specialists are trained in laser technology, which might restrict your choices for choosing a cosmetic surgeon.
Finally, while the laser can automate specific facets of the procedure, the surgical procedure still calls for a competent doctor to make sure successful outcomes.
Relative Analysis of Both Methods
For a detailed understanding of cataract surgical procedure techniques, it's essential to carry out a relative evaluation of both conventional and laser-assisted methods.
Conventional cataract surgical procedure involves manual lacerations and the use of handheld tools to separate and get rid of the cloudy lens.
On the other hand, laser-assisted cataract surgical procedure uses advanced technology to develop precise lacerations and separate the cataract with laser energy before removing it.
In terms of accuracy, laser-assisted methods offer a higher degree of precision compared to typical techniques. Using lasers enables personalization of the procedure based on each person's eye composition, potentially causing far better visual end results.
Nevertheless, laser-assisted cataract surgical procedure often tends to be extra costly than typical surgical treatment, which might limit accessibility for some people.
While both techniques are effective in bring back vision damaged by cataracts, the choice between typical and laser-assisted methods usually relies on factors such as price, precision, and individual person demands.
Consulting with your eye doctor can help determine the most suitable strategy for your cataract surgical procedure.
